Output e3866e8aaea53527b71a627f49d7eb9b4fd0559d01835ecd0faefbb62674ed5b:0

value
374846897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a67a0eeba974332ecb6a2913e4524f8e85654f OP_EQUAL
address
3JLnLU3RbCwGR5xg7Y788RnooHUcU21Tb3
transaction
e3866e8aaea53527b71a627f49d7eb9b4fd0559d01835ecd0faefbb62674ed5b
spent
true